What this data tells you about Samaan

Jennifer Samaan is a physician assistant in Harrison, NJ, with 5 years of NPI registration. Based on federal Medicare data, Samaan performed 22 Medicare services in 2023. These records do not provide a deduplicated patient total.

Between the years covered by Open Payments, Samaan received a total of $5,352 from 43 pharmaceutical and/or device companies across 193 payment records. A record can group multiple payments. These transfers are publicly reported through CMS Open Payments. Disclosure alone does not establish their effect on care. A reliable breakdown by payment category is not available in this snapshot. Patients may wish to discuss these relationships with their provider.

What does Data Coverage mean?
Data Coverage (currently Very High for Samaan) measures how much public federal data is available about a provider. It is not a quality rating. A "Very High" or "High" level means the provider has data across multiple federal sources (NPPES, PECOS, Medicare Utilization, Open Payments), indicating the presence of registry, enrollment, activity or payment records, not verified experience or clinical quality. A "Low" or "Moderate" level may simply mean the provider is newer, does not see Medicare patients, or has not received any industry payments — none of which are inherently negative.
